threat isn't the only issue. for progression, when you're tanking bosses, the 3% avoidance and 2% mitigation from frost is really important. i find it's single target threat very good if you're good with your KM procs.
i also find frost to be the strongest on trash pack agro. DnD > (deathchill)HB > BB > BT > BB with HB glyphed makes for very sticky trash mobs.
on the 3.1 ptr i had a plan very similar to your, going blood for single targets and frost for aoe but, after a lot of testing, my threat just didn't improve enough with blood to make the lack of core tanking stats worth it.

Aleanos
25 RP is enough to max out the benefit from the DS glyph.
Blood gorged wont be in effect 100% of the time yes, but the 10% ArP is still something not to be taken lightly (as it boosts more or less 60%+ of your TPS).
Edit: I know a blood Dk tank that's doing Ulduar, his RS's hit/crit in the 4-8k range (he claim to have gotten a 11k one aswell) so yeah, RS rocks.
